Bharat Ratna: Pandit Bhimsen Gururaj Joshi Year: 2008State / Country: Karnataka - India Notes: Hindustani classical singer Ustad Bismillah Khan Year: 2001State / Country: Uttar Pradesh Notes: Classical Maestro Lata Mangeshkar Year: 2001State / Country: Maharashtra Notes: Play back singer. Ravi Shankar Year: 1999State / Country: west bengal Notes: Classical sitar player. Amartya Sen Year: 1999State / Country: West Bengal Notes: Nobel Laureate (Economics, 1998), Economist. Gopinath Bordoloi Year: 1999State / Country: Assam Notes: Posthumous, freedom fighter Jayaprakash Narayan Year: 1998State / Country: Uttar Pradesh Notes: Posthumous, Freedom Fighter, Social Reformer. Chidambaram Subramaniam Year: 1998State / Country: Tamil Nadu Notes: Freedom Fighter, Minister of Agriculture(Father of Green revolution). M. S. Subbulakshmi Year: 1998State / Country: Tamil Nadu Notes: Classical singer. A.P.J. Abdul Kalam Year: 1997State / Country: Tamil Nadu Notes: Former President, Scientist. Gulzarilal Nanda Year: 1997State / Country: Punjab Notes: Freedom Fighter, former Prime Minister. Aruna Asaf Ali Year: 1997State / Country: West Bengal Notes: Posthumous, Freedom Fighter. Satyajit Ray Year: 1992State / Country: West Bengal Notes: Legendary Indian Film Director J. R. D. Tata Year: 1992State / Country: Maharashtra Notes: Industrialist and philanthropist. Maulana Abul Kalam Azad Year: 1992State / Country: West Bengal Notes: Posthumous, Freedom Fighter, Educator. Morarji Desai Year: 1991State / Country: Gujarat Notes: Former Prime Minister, Freedom Fighter. Sardar Vallabhbhai Patel Year: 1991State / Country: Gujarat Notes: Posthumous, Freedom Fighter, First Home Minister of India. Rajiv Gandhi Year: 1991State / Country: New Delhi Notes: Posthumous, Former Prime Minister Nelson Mandela Year: 1990State / Country: South Africa Notes: Second non-citizen and first non-Indian, Leader of Anti-Apartheid movement. B. R. Ambedkar Year: 1990State / Country: Maharashtra Notes: Posthumous, Architect-Indian Constitution, Leader of Buddhist people of India M. G. Ramachandran Year: 1988State / Country: Tamil Nadu Notes: Posthumous, Chief Minister-Tamil Nadu, Actor. Khan Abdul Ghaffar Khan Year: 1987State / Country: Pakistan Notes: First non-citizen, Freedom Fighter. Acharya Vinoba Bhave Year: 1983State / Country: Maharashtra Notes: Posthumous, Social Reformer, Freedom Figher. Agnes Gonxha Bojaxhiu (Mother Teresa) Year: 1980State / Country: West Bengal Notes: Naturalized Indian citizen, Nobel Laureate (Peace, 1979). K. Kamaraj Year: 1976State / Country: Tamil Nadu Notes: Posthumous, Freedom Fighter, Chief Minister-Tamil Nadu. V. V. Giri Year: 1975State / Country: Andhra Pradesh Notes: Former President, Trade Unionist. Indira Gandhi Year: 1971State / Country: Uttar Pradesh Notes: Former Prime Minister Lal Bahadur Shastri Year: 1966State / Country: Uttar Pradesh Notes: Posthumous, Second Prime Minister, Freedom Fighter Pandurang Vaman Kane Year: 1963State / Country: Maharashtra Notes: Indologist and Sanskrit scholar Zakir Hussain Year: 1963State / Country: Andhra Pradesh Notes: Former President, Scholar. Rajendra Prasad Year: 1962State / Country: Bihar Notes: First President, Freedom Fighter, Jurist Purushottam Das Tandon Year: 1961State / Country: Uttar Pradesh Notes: Freedom Fighter, Educationalist. B. C. Roy Year: 1961State / Country: West Bengal Notes: Physician, Politician Dhondo Keshav Karve Year: 1958State / Country: Maharashtra Notes: Educationist, Social Reformer Govind Ballabh Pant Year: 1957State / Country: Uttar Pradesh Notes: Freedom Fighter, Home Minister Bhagwan Das Year: 1955State / Country: Uttar Pradesh Notes: Philosopher, Freedom Fighter Sir Mokshagundam Visvesvarayya Year: 1955State / Country: Karnataka Notes: Civil Engineer Jawaharlal Nehru Year: 1955State / Country: Uttar Pradesh Notes: First Prime Minister, Freedom Fighter, Author. C. V. Raman Year: 1954State / Country: Tamil Nadu Notes: Nobel-prize winning Physicist Chakravarti Rajagopalachari Year: 1954State / Country: Tamil Nadu Notes: Last Governor-General, Freedom Fighter. Sarvepalli Radhakrishnan Year: 1954State / Country: Tamil Nadu Notes: Second President, First Vice President, Philosopher.
